Page 3: Angel Investing in Today’s Economy

 

Average MedianNumber of investments 7.4 5Total monies invested $1.78 mil $1.06 milDollars invested per round $241,528Dollars invested per angel $31,457Number of new companies 4

Source: 2007 ACA Angel Group Confidence Survey

2006 Angel Group Investment Data

• 72% co-invested with venture capital firms• 29% had distributions to investors• Investment up 23% from 2005

Page 9: Angel Investing in Today’s Economy

 

Preliminary Distribution of Outcomes

Loss 47%1 to 4X 26%4 to 6X 15%6 to 30X 8%30X + 4%

Page 10: Angel Investing in Today’s Economy

 

Profile of Angels - Median

Years investing 7Number of investments 7Total exits/ closures 1Years as entrepreneur 13Number ventures founded 2Age 57Percent of wealth in angel investing 10%Education Masters degree
